Transaction 33c912305ec165e57089b3fb138faf58e577161597e8c27176b0633b4d19077a
1 Input
1 Output
-
33c912305ec165e57089b3fb138faf58e577161597e8c27176b0633b4d19077a:0
- value
- 5224
- script pubkey
- OP_0 OP_PUSHBYTES_20 87cf0d0a0da5ddb8332d0548201fe83d4c456ab3
- address
- bc1qsl8s6zsd5hwmsvedq4yzq8lg84xy264nm6ac5u